What Happens during Prometaphase? … During prometaphase, phosphorylation of nuclear lamins by M-CDK causes the nuclear membrane to break down into numerous small vesicles. As a result, the spindle microtubules now have direct access to the genetic material of the cell.

What major events occur in prometaphase of mitosis?
The major event marking a cell’s entry to prometaphase is the breakdown of the nuclear envelope into small vesicles. Kinetochores also become fully matured on the centromeres of the chromosomes. The disruption of the nuclear envelope allows for the mitotic spindles to gain access to the mature kinetochores.

What happens to chromosomes during prometaphase?
In prometaphase, the nuclear membrane breaks apart into numerous “membrane vesicles”, and the chromosomes inside form protein structures called kinetochores. … Forces exerted by protein “motors” associated with spindle microtubules move the chromosomes toward the centre of the cell.

Who first observed mitosis?
Walter Flemming described chromosome behavior during animal cell division. Flemming was one of the first cytologists and the first to detail how chromosomes move during mitosis, or cell division.
What stage occurs after cytokinesis?
The G1 phase is a period in the cell cycle during interphase, after cytokinesis (process whereby a single cell is divided into two identical daughter cells whenever the cytoplasm is divided) and before the S phase. For many cells, this phase is the major period of cell growth during its lifespan.

What is Chiasmata Terminalization?
The two homologous chromosomes do not completely separate but it remains attached together at one or more points as indicated by X arrangements known as Chiasmata. The displacement of Chiasmata is termed as terminalization which is completed in Diakinesis stage.
